The Landscape of Crowd Management in Poland

Analyzing the demand for high-durability perimeter security in Central Europe.

In Poland, the demand for crowd barriers is heavily influenced by the country's vibrant public event culture and the strategic importance of its logistics hubs. From large-scale music festivals in Warsaw to religious gatherings in Kraków, the need for robust physical separation is critical for public safety.

Climate plays a decisive role in material selection. Poland's seasonal transitions—ranging from humid summers to freezing winters—require metal barricades with superior hot-dip galvanization to prevent corrosion and structural fatigue caused by moisture and road salts used during winter.

Economically, Poland has become a regional hub for manufacturing and infrastructure. This shift has increased the requirement for temporary crowd control barricades not only for events but also for managing pedestrian flow around massive construction sites and industrial zones across the Masovian and Silesian regions.

Evolution of Barrier Technology in Poland

From basic iron fences to engineered modular safety systems.

Market Development History

Prior to the 2000s, crowd control in Poland relied heavily on static, heavy iron piping or wooden structures that were labor-intensive to deploy and prone to rapid oxidation. These early systems lacked the interlocking stability required for modern safety protocols.

Between 2010 and 2020, the industry shifted toward standardized metal crowd control barriers. The introduction of interlocking hook-and-eye mechanisms allowed for faster deployment and created a continuous "wall" effect, significantly reducing the risk of barrier collapse under crowd pressure.

In recent years, the focus has moved toward "smart" engineering. Modern barriers now feature lightweight yet high-tensile alloys and ergonomic feet designs that ensure stability on the uneven cobblestones common in Poland's historic Old Towns (Stare Miasto).

Common Questions on Crowd Control in Poland

Expert answers to technical and logistical queries regarding barrier deployment.

What is the best coating for steel barricades in the Polish climate?

We recommend hot-dip galvanization. It creates a thick, protective zinc layer that prevents rust during Poland's humid summers and resists the corrosive effects of road salts used in winter.

How do metal crowd control barriers ensure stability on cobblestone streets?

Our barriers feature wide-base, flat-foot designs that maximize surface contact, preventing tipping and wobbling on the irregular surfaces common in Polish historic centers.

Are your crowd control barricades compliant with EU safety regulations?

Yes, our products are manufactured to align with EN 13200 standards, ensuring specific load-bearing capacities and the absence of sharp edges to protect the public.

Can these crowd barriers be used for long-term perimeter fencing?

While designed for temporary use, our heavy-duty galvanized steel options are durable enough for medium-term installations, provided they are properly anchored.

How do the interlocking mechanisms prevent barrier failure?

Our reinforced hook-and-loop system creates a cohesive chain. When pressure is applied, the force is distributed across multiple units rather than a single point, preventing collapse.
